Silverstein is a renowned Canadian post-hardcore band that has made significant contributions to the alternative music scene since their formation in 2000. Known for their energetic performances and emotionally charged lyrics, Silverstein has garnered a dedicated fanbase over the years. Silverstein's discography includes several acclaimed albums, with standout tracks such as "My Heroine" and "Vices." The Fillmore - Philadelphia is a premier concert venue located in the vibrant Fishtown neighborhood. With a capacity of approximately 2,500 guests, the main room features a general admission standing floor, allowing for an immersive concert experience. For those seeking a more intimate setting, The Foundry, an adjacent smaller room, hosts select performances.
The seating arrangement at The Fillmore is primarily general admission, which fosters an energetic environment where fans can engage closely with the performers. While premium seating options are limited and available for select shows, they provide an excellent vantage point for those looking to enhance their concert experience. It is advisable to arrive early to secure the best spots on the floor.
Parking at The Fillmore - Philadelphia is convenient with two official parking lots available for concertgoers. Pre-paid parking can be purchased when ordering tickets online, ensuring a hassle-free arrival. The lots open two hours before door time, allowing ample time for attendees to park and enjoy pre-show activities.
For those considering rideshare options, Uber and Lyft are popular choices with drop-off points conveniently located near the venue. Public transit via SEPTA is also accessible; attendees can take the Market-Frankford Line to Girard Station and walk south on N. Front St.
